Caption
Nine male heads, arranged according to the shape of their chin, Le Menton, page, photomechanical print, Six photographs in side view, numbers 7, 8 and 9 taken in front view., inscription: 'Menton fuyant., Menton bilobé.', number: '1., 9.', number: 'Planche 40.', France, c. 1880 - in or before 1893, paper, collotype, photogravure, height 243 mm x width 157 mm, head (human) (sideview, profile), A vertically oriented page shows a grid of nine sepia-toned portrait photographs of men, arranged in three rows and three columns, each portrait framed by thin lines and separated by horizontal and vertical rules; the top row contains two profile views facing right and one front-facing view, the middle row repeats two right-facing profiles and one frontal portrait of a bald man with a mustache and beard, and the bottom row shows two right-facing profile portraits and one frontal portrait of a younger man with a mustache; the men display varied hairstyles and facial hair, including close-cropped hair, curly hair, mustaches, beards, and clean-shaven faces, and they wear different collars and jackets; the page background is a light aged paper with a rectangular double-line border around the content.
